An HVAC capacitor is an electrical component that stores energy and releases it in short bursts to start and run motors in the HVAC system. These motors are primarily responsible for powering the compressor, fan, and blower. Capacitors are essential for the proper functioning of the HVAC system, as they provide the necessary electrical boost to overcome the inertia of the motors and keep them running smoothly. - Start Capacitors: These capacitors provide a high surge of energy to start the motor. They are designed for short-term use and are typically disconnected from the circuit once the motor reaches its operating speed.
- Run Capacitors: These capacitors provide a continuous boost of energy to keep the motor running efficiently. They are designed for continuous use and are typically connected to the circuit throughout the motor’s operation.

HVAC capacitors are subjected to harsh operating conditions, including high temperatures, voltage fluctuations, and exposure to environmental elements. These factors can cause the capacitor to degrade over time, leading to failure. - Heat: High temperatures can cause the electrolyte inside the capacitor to evaporate, reducing its capacitance and eventually leading to failure.
- Voltage Fluctuations: Voltage surges and dips can stress the capacitor, causing it to overheat and fail.
- Age: Capacitors have a limited lifespan, typically ranging from 5 to 15 years. As they age, their performance degrades, and they become more susceptible to failure.
- Manufacturing Defects: In some cases, capacitors may fail due to manufacturing defects. These defects can cause premature failure, even in relatively new capacitors.

- Hard Starting: The HVAC system may struggle to start, taking longer than usual to turn on. This is often accompanied by a humming or clicking sound.
- Reduced Cooling or Heating: The HVAC system may not be able to cool or heat the space effectively. This is because the motor is not running at its full capacity, reducing the airflow and overall performance.
- Increased Energy Consumption: A failing capacitor can cause the motor to work harder, leading to increased energy consumption and higher utility bills.
- Overheating: The motor may overheat due to the capacitor’s inability to provide the necessary electrical boost. This can damage the motor and other components of the HVAC system.
- Humming or Buzzing Noise: A failing capacitor may produce a humming or buzzing noise, indicating that it is struggling to function properly.
- Physical Damage: Inspect the capacitor for signs of physical damage, such as bulging, leaking, or cracking. These are clear indicators that the capacitor needs to be replaced.

- Turn Off the Power: Before starting any work on the HVAC system, turn off the power at the circuit breaker. This is crucial for preventing electrical shock.
- Locate the Capacitor: The capacitor is typically located inside the outdoor unit of the HVAC system, near the compressor.
- Remove the Access Panel: Use a screwdriver to remove the access panel that covers the capacitor.
- Discharge the Capacitor: Before touching the capacitor, discharge it to prevent electrical shock. Use a screwdriver with an insulated handle to short the terminals of the capacitor. Be careful not to touch the metal parts of the screwdriver.
- Take Pictures of the Wiring: Use a camera or smartphone to take pictures of the wiring connections before disconnecting them. This will help you reconnect the wires correctly later on.
- Disconnect the Wires: Use pliers to disconnect the wires from the capacitor terminals. Make sure to label the wires or take detailed notes so that you can reconnect them correctly.
- Remove the Old Capacitor: Remove the old capacitor from its mounting bracket.
- Install the New Capacitor: Place the new capacitor in the mounting bracket.
- Reconnect the Wires: Reconnect the wires to the capacitor terminals, matching the labels or notes you made earlier.
- Replace the Access Panel: Replace the access panel and secure it with screws.
- Turn On the Power: Turn on the power at the circuit breaker.
- Test the HVAC System: Turn on the HVAC system and observe its performance. Make sure that it starts smoothly and runs efficiently.

- Voltage: The voltage rating of the replacement capacitor must be equal to or greater than the voltage rating of the original capacitor. Using a capacitor with a lower voltage rating can lead to premature failure.
- Capacitance: The capacitance of the replacement capacitor must match the capacitance of the original capacitor. Capacitance is measured in microfarads (ยตF). Using a capacitor with a different capacitance can affect the performance of the motor and the overall efficiency of the HVAC system.
- Type: Determine whether the original capacitor is a start capacitor or a run capacitor. Start capacitors are designed for short-term use, while run capacitors are designed for continuous use. Using the wrong type of capacitor can damage the motor.
- Physical Size: Ensure that the replacement capacitor is the same size and shape as the original capacitor. This will ensure that it fits properly in the mounting bracket.
- Brand and Quality: Choose a replacement capacitor from a reputable brand. High-quality capacitors are more reliable and have a longer lifespan.

- Keep the Outdoor Unit Clean: Remove any debris, such as leaves, twigs, and grass clippings, from around the outdoor unit. This will improve airflow and prevent the capacitor from overheating.
- Clean the Condenser Coils: Clean the condenser coils regularly to remove dirt and grime. This will improve the efficiency of the HVAC system and reduce stress on the capacitor.
- Monitor Voltage Fluctuations: Install a surge protector to protect the HVAC system from voltage fluctuations.
- Schedule Regular Inspections: Schedule regular inspections with a qualified HVAC technician. The technician can inspect the capacitor and other components of the HVAC system and identify any potential problems before they lead to failure.

- DIY Replacement: If you choose to replace the capacitor yourself, the cost will be limited to the price of the replacement capacitor, which typically ranges from $20 to $100.
- Professional Replacement: If you hire a professional to replace the capacitor, the cost will include the price of the capacitor plus labor costs. Labor costs can range from $100 to $300, depending on the complexity of the job and the hourly rate of the technician.
